With war on the horizon in medieval Ireland, everything is at stake for mortal and magical folk alike. The third volume in the critically acclaimed GAEL SONG historical fantasy series. A LoveReading Book of the Year!

THE OLD WORLD WILL DIE IN FLAMES.

Ireland, 1011 AD. The mortal kingdoms rise up against High King Brian Boru as they seek to wrest his crown from him. Yet the real struggle is between the two magical races of Ireland, the Fomorians and the Descendants, eternal enemies who both seek dominion over the mortal world.

Gormflaith, King Brian's queen, remains unmasked as the powerful Fomorian she is. Gormflaith plans to gain mastery over Ireland and destroy the Descendants in one fell swoop... but she cannot do it alone.

The Descendants are bitterly divided. Fódla, a Descendant who was once part of King Brian’s inner circle, must use this division to thwart a treacherous plot long in the making – even if it means sacrificing herself. But with other lives on the line, can Fódla reveal the evil in time?

As secret schemes come to deadly fruition, the only possible outcome is war. Ireland has bled red and often, but the coming clash will change the course of history for ever.
